From muscle building and metabolism to hormonal balance and disease prevention, protein is an essential nutrient for women's health.

Women of all ages need enough protein to help us with our  energy, focus, appetite control, and for tissue repair. Across different life stages like pregnancy and menopause, protein becomes even more critical, supporting fetal development, maintaining muscle tissue and bone density, and managing moods, hormonal fluctuations, weight gain, and even sleep.

Understanding this macronutrient's importance and making sure we’re getting adequate protein in our diet can lead to better health and quality of life.
